activity_user_profile.xml 12.1 KB
<?xml version="1.0" encoding="utf-8"?>
<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
    xmlns:app="http://schemas.android.com/apk/res-auto"
    xmlns:tools="http://schemas.android.com/tools"
    android:layout_width="match_parent"
    android:layout_height="match_parent"
    android:background="@color/whitecolor"
    tools:context=".activities.sidemenu.UserProfile">


    <LinearLayout
        android:id="@+id/rl_toollayout"
        android:layout_width="match_parent"
        android:layout_height="@dimen/fifty_fiveheight"
        android:orientation="horizontal">

        <ImageView
            android:id="@+id/back_icon"
            android:layout_width="@dimen/forty_fivewidth"
            android:layout_height="match_parent"
            android:padding="@dimen/padding_ten"
            android:src="@drawable/icon_back"
            android:tint="@color/blackcolor" />

        <TextView
            android:layout_width="0dp"
            android:layout_height="match_parent"
            android:layout_weight="1"
            android:gravity="center"
            android:text="@string/profile_txt_pro"
            android:textColor="@color/blackcolor"
            android:textStyle="bold"
            android:textSize="@dimen/eighteenText_size" />

        <ImageView
            android:visibility="gone"
            android:id="@+id/map_icon"
            android:layout_width="@dimen/thirty_width"
            android:layout_height="match_parent"
            android:layout_marginEnd="@dimen/layout_marginEnd_five"
            android:padding="@dimen/padding_two"
            android:src="@drawable/icon_map"
            android:tint="@color/blackcolor" />

        <ImageView
            android:id="@+id/notification_icon"
            android:layout_width="@dimen/thirty_width"
            android:layout_height="match_parent"
            android:layout_marginEnd="@dimen/layout_marginEnd_five"
            android:padding="@dimen/padding_five"
            android:src="@drawable/icon_bell"
            android:tint="@color/blackcolor" />


    </LinearLayout>


    <ScrollView
            android:layout_width="match_parent"
            android:layout_height="match_parent"
            android:layout_below="@+id/rl_toollayout"
            android:scrollbarThumbVertical="@color/transparent"
            android:scrollbars="vertical">

        <LinearLayout
                android:layout_width="match_parent"
                android:layout_height="wrap_content"
                android:orientation="vertical">

            <RelativeLayout
                    android:id="@+id/rl_edit_layout"
                    android:layout_width="@dimen/thirty_width"
                    android:layout_height="@dimen/thirty_height"
                    android:layout_gravity="end"
                    android:layout_marginEnd="@dimen/layout_marginEnd_twelve"
                    android:layout_marginTop="@dimen/layout_marginTop_eight"
                    android:background="@drawable/yellow_circle_bg"
                    android:gravity="center"
                    android:visibility="gone">

                <ImageView
                        android:layout_width="28dp"
                        android:layout_height="17dp"
                        android:layout_alignParentEnd="true"
                        android:layout_marginEnd="0dp"
                        android:padding="@dimen/padding_five"
                        android:src="@drawable/icon_pencil"/>
            </RelativeLayout>

            <RelativeLayout
                    android:id="@+id/rl_edit_password"
                    android:layout_width="@dimen/thirty_width"
                    android:layout_height="@dimen/thirty_height"
                    android:layout_gravity="end"
                    android:layout_marginEnd="@dimen/layout_marginEnd_twelve"
                    android:layout_marginTop="@dimen/layout_marginTop_eight"
                    android:background="@drawable/yellow_circle_bg"
                    android:gravity="center"
                    android:visibility="gone">

                <ImageView
                        android:layout_width="wrap_content"
                        android:layout_height="wrap_content"
                        android:layout_alignParentEnd="true"
                        android:layout_marginEnd="0dp"
                        android:padding="@dimen/padding_five"
                        android:src="@drawable/icon_update_password"/>
            </RelativeLayout>

            <de.hdodenhof.circleimageview.CircleImageView
                    android:id="@+id/profile_img"
                    android:layout_width="@dimen/oneHundred_ten_width"
                    android:layout_height="@dimen/oneHundred_ten_height"
                    android:layout_gravity="center"
                    android:src="@drawable/user"/>

            <TextView
                    android:visibility="gone"
                    android:id="@+id/update_textview"
                    android:layout_width="match_parent"
                    android:layout_height="wrap_content"
                    android:layout_marginTop="@dimen/layout_marginTop_fifteen"
                    android:gravity="center"
                    android:text="@string/updateimg_txt_pro"
                    android:textColor="@color/blackcolor"
                    android:textSize="@dimen/fourteenText_size"/>


            <LinearLayout
                    android:layout_width="match_parent"
                    android:layout_height="wrap_content"
                    android:layout_marginEnd="@dimen/layout_marginEnd_sixty"
                    android:layout_marginStart="@dimen/layout_marginStart_sixty"
                    android:layout_marginTop="@dimen/layout_marginTop_thirty"
                    android:background="@drawable/help_box_bg"
                    android:orientation="vertical">


                <EditText
                        android:id="@+id/user_name_txt"
                        android:layout_width="match_parent"
                        android:layout_height="@dimen/fifty_height"
                        android:background="@color/transparent"
                        android:hint="@string/name_txt_pro"
                        android:inputType="textAutoComplete"
                        android:paddingStart="@dimen/padding_start_ten"
                        android:textColorHint="@color/blackcolor"
                        android:textSize="@dimen/fifteenText_size"/>

                <View
                        android:layout_width="match_parent"
                        android:layout_height="1dp"
                        android:background="@color/gray"/>

                <EditText
                        android:id="@+id/user_role_txt"
                        android:layout_width="match_parent"
                        android:layout_height="@dimen/fifty_height"
                        android:background="@color/transparent"
                        android:hint="@string/role_txt_pro"
                        android:inputType="textAutoComplete"
                        android:paddingStart="@dimen/padding_start_ten"
                        android:textColorHint="@color/textcolor"
                        android:textSize="@dimen/fifteenText_size"/>

                <View
                        android:layout_width="match_parent"
                        android:layout_height="1dp"
                        android:background="@color/gray"/>

                <EditText
                        android:id="@+id/user_id_txt"
                        android:layout_width="match_parent"
                        android:layout_height="@dimen/fifty_height"
                        android:background="@color/transparent"
                        android:hint="@string/user_id_txt_pro"
                        android:inputType="textAutoComplete"
                        android:paddingStart="@dimen/padding_start_ten"
                        android:textColorHint="@color/textcolor"
                        android:textSize="@dimen/fifteenText_size"/>

                <View
                        android:layout_width="match_parent"
                        android:layout_height="1dp"
                        android:background="@color/gray"/>

                <EditText
                        android:id="@+id/access_codetxt"
                        android:layout_width="match_parent"
                        android:layout_height="@dimen/fifty_height"
                        android:background="@color/transparent"
                        android:hint="@string/user_password_txt_pro"
                        android:inputType="textPassword"
                        android:paddingStart="@dimen/padding_start_ten"
                        android:textColorHint="@color/textcolor"
                        android:textSize="@dimen/fifteenText_size"/>
                <View
                        android:id="@+id/comfirm_view"
                        android:layout_width="match_parent"
                        android:layout_height="1dp"
                        android:visibility="gone"
                        android:background="@color/gray"/>
                <EditText
                        android:id="@+id/comfirm_access_codetxt"
                        android:layout_width="match_parent"
                        android:layout_height="@dimen/fifty_height"
                        android:background="@color/transparent"
                        android:visibility="gone"
                        android:hint="@string/user_confirm_password_txt"
                        android:inputType="textPassword"
                        android:paddingStart="@dimen/padding_start_ten"
                        android:textColorHint="@color/textcolor"
                        android:textSize="@dimen/fifteenText_size"/>
                <View
                        android:layout_width="match_parent"
                        android:layout_height="1dp"
                        android:background="@color/gray"/>

                <EditText
                        android:id="@+id/user_mail_edit_txt"
                        android:layout_width="match_parent"
                        android:layout_height="@dimen/fifty_height"
                        android:background="@color/transparent"
                        android:hint="@string/email_txt_pro"
                        android:inputType="textAutoComplete"
                        android:paddingStart="@dimen/padding_start_ten"
                        android:textColorHint="@color/textcolor"
                        android:textSize="@dimen/fifteenText_size"/>


                <View
                        android:layout_width="match_parent"
                        android:layout_height="1dp"
                        android:background="@color/gray"/>

                <EditText
                        android:id="@+id/dmobile_number_editxt"
                        android:layout_width="match_parent"
                        android:layout_height="@dimen/fifty_height"
                        android:background="@color/transparent"
                        android:hint="@string/phone_txt_pro"
                        android:inputType="number"
                        android:paddingStart="@dimen/padding_start_ten"
                        android:textColorHint="@color/textcolor"
                        android:textSize="@dimen/fifteenText_size"/>

            </LinearLayout>


            <TextView
                    android:visibility="gone"
                    android:id="@+id/save_txt"
                    android:layout_width="match_parent"
                    android:layout_height="@dimen/fifty_height"
                    android:layout_marginBottom="@dimen/layout_marginBottom_fifty"
                    android:layout_marginEnd="@dimen/layout_marginEnd_sixty"
                    android:layout_marginStart="@dimen/layout_marginStart_sixty"
                    android:layout_marginTop="@dimen/layout_marginTop_twenty"
                    android:background="@drawable/yellow_bg"
                    android:gravity="center"
                    android:text="@string/update_txt_pro"
                    android:textColor="@color/whitecolor"
                    android:textSize="@dimen/fourteenText_size"/>

        </LinearLayout>
    </ScrollView>

</RelativeLayout>